Rather too posh for the likes of me, Steven Saunders at The Lowry serves a pretty good Sunday Roast dinner, although it would have been good to get a steak knife with my roast beef.
The Lowry theme of fancy for fancy's sake does seem to carry through to the restaurant. Prices aren't too upmarket though and I highly recommend the bread-and-butter pudding!
The setting is relaxing, the restaurant has waterside views across the docks.
Typical prices are as follows: Lunch (2 courses, 12-3pm): £10
Pre-theatre Dinner (2 courses, 5-6.45pm): £12
